West Virginia home charging cost for the 2026 BMW iX xDrive45 (20 inch Wheels)

A 2026 BMW iX xDrive45 (20 inch Wheels) draws 36 kWh per 100 miles per the EPA; at West Virginia's 15.42¢/kWh residential rate that's $5.55 per 100 miles charged at home, versus $16.02 for a 25.5-mpg gas car covering the same distance. Charging at home costs a fraction of what gas would here: 65.4% less than gas per mile, here specifically.

Annual cost, at 15 thousands miles a year

At fueleconomy.gov's default of 15,000 annual miles, the 2026 BMW iX xDrive45 (20 inch Wheels) costs roughly $833 a year to charge at home in West Virginia, against roughly $2,403 a year for an equivalent gas car. That's a savings of about $1,570 a year.

Cost of a full charge

Covering the 2026 BMW iX xDrive45 (20 inch Wheels)'s EPA-rated 312-mile range takes about 112.3 kWh, which costs about $17.32 at West Virginia's residential rate — figured from the EPA's own combined range and consumption numbers, not the pack's nameplate capacity.

Before you install a home charger in West Virginia

The numbers above assume Level 2 home charging is already in place — the electrical work behind that is a real, separate cost that varies by panel, wiring, and local labor rates, not something this page's per-mile math includes.
